The Qwilfish from Team Rocket Returns is a true gem, priced at $34.99 for the Reverse Holofoil variant. This card commands a high price due to its nostalgia factor, being part of the iconic Team Rocket Returns set, which is revered for its darker themes and beloved by collectors. The artwork, featuring a menacing Qwilfish with a splash of danger, captures the essence of the set perfectly. Plus, scarcity plays a role; fewer copies are floating around compared to more recent sets, making it a coveted addition for those trying to snag a piece of TCG history.
Next up is the Reverse Holofoil Qwilfish from Expedition Base Set, currently valued at $7.96. This card is a nostalgic throwback to the early days of the TCG, and its status as a Reverse Holofoil gives it that extra shine collectors crave. The artwork is classic and captures Qwilfish’s quirky vibe perfectly. While it’s technically a 'common,' the early set's demand means this card has risen above its intended rarity, appealing to both nostalgia-driven collectors and those looking for something unique from the very first expansion.
Valued at $4.57, the Reverse Holofoil Qwilfish from HeartGold & SoulSilver is a standout for fans of that nostalgic era. This set was a love letter to classic Pokémon, and this card is no exception. The artwork features Qwilfish looking adorably defiant, which resonates with collectors who remember their childhood adventures. Plus, the combination of the HeartGold & SoulSilver sets' collectibility and the Reverse Holofoil treatment keeps this card in demand, despite its uncommon status.
At $1.97, the Qwilfish from Secret Wonders may not break the bank, but it holds a special place for fans of the Diamond and Pearl era. As a common card, it has an accessible price point, yet the Reverse Holofoil variant adds a level of charm that makes it more appealing. The artwork, portraying Qwilfish in a playful pose, captures its personality. This card appeals to collectors who appreciate the nostalgic design of the set and want to snag a piece of the mid-2000s TCG magic.
The 1st Edition Qwilfish from Neo Revelation is a classic, priced at $1.57. First editions are always a hot ticket, as they represent the beginning of Pokémon card collecting for many. This card features artsy watercolor-like designs that encapsulate the unique style of the Neo era, making it a visually appealing piece. Its common status means it won’t make you cry at checkout, but the 1st Edition stamp gives it a charm that many collectors can't resist, making it a true collectible.
